Learning Objectives

5 objectives
  • Trace the evolution and key milestones in the history of computer applications.
  • Explain the fundamental functions and components of operating systems.
  • Demonstrate basic pro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ite and Google Workspace applications.
  • Understand and apply principles of file management and cloud computing.
  • Utilize introductory graphic design and data analysis tools to create and interpret digital content.
